Review of Woodfire RH 17 DS

Very good stove but with some issues...

We purchased the Woodfire RH17 DS stove from an on-line company for installation in our new build house, in a 3/4 height wall separating the living room from the dining room.

The stove looks amazing and appears to be well made. Installation was simple and the supplier has been amazing. Their pre-sales support was fantastic. Their team are very knowledgeable and we used them to design and supply the flue as well. Their after sales support has been equally as good too and they have quickly fixed the problems that we have encountered.

Positives of this stove:

+ A lot of stove for a low price. We were on a fairly tight budget and could not find anything similar for anywhere near the price.

+ Clean, uncluttered appearance to the visible parts of the stove. The simplicity of the glass doors and controls are lovely.

+ The stove itself is very well made and put together.

+ Dimensions suited our installation perfectly.

Negatives of this stove:

- No matter what we try, it has proved impossible to keep the glass doors clean. I do not think there is enough air flow over the glass. I also think having just a single air control instead of two does not help this problem. We are burning dry, seasoned hardwood and still the glass needs cleaning every two weeks to be able to see the fire. The supplier sent us a moisture meter to check the wood we were burning and it was all dry enough (under 20% moisture content). For me, this is the biggest negative of this stove as, to me, the point of a double sided glass door stove is to see through it and see the fire.

- The firebricks that came with the stove broke down and crumbled quickly. We are told that harder bricks are now being made, make sure you get these.

- The rope seal around the doors failed after approx. 12 months use, letting smoke in to the room. The supplier sent a replacement which we have fitted and this works well.

- Make sure your stove is UK spec with a hole in the top of the firebox for sweeping the chimney. Ours was not. but again our supplier fixed this, but it should not have needed fixing.

Summary:

As long as you don't mind cleaning the doors quite regularly then this is a great stove at an amazing price point. If you have a larger budget I would suggest looking at similar stoves with better air controls.
